Abstract

We demonstrate a diode-pumped, broadly tunable single-frequency Cr:ZnSe laser. This system utilizes a 5 mm Cr:ZnSe crystal, pumped by laser diodes (LDs) with a central wavelength of 1710 nm. To achieve unidirectional operation, a retro-reflecting device is used to reflect the self-seeded beam back into the resonator. Single-frequency operation is achieved by finely adjusting three birefringent filters (BRFs) in the resonator, and the linewidth is maintained at less than 29 MHz throughout this tuning range. This compact diode-pumped, broadly tunable single-frequency Cr:ZnSe laser has significant potential applications for detecting various gas molecules.
